Software Verification Engineer

Logo of Codekeeper

Codekeeper

πŸ“Remote - Worldwide

Job highlights

Summary

Join our team as a Software Verification Engineer and play a crucial role in ensuring the quality and reliability of our customer's software. This dynamic role requires a blend of technical expertise, problem-solving skills, and teamwork. You will conduct software verification, analyze technical documentation, resolve build issues, and collaborate with team members and clients. The position involves working across backend, frontend, and DevOps, demanding versatility and adaptability. We are accepting applications for the next two months and offer a remote-first work environment with a supportive team and ample growth opportunities.

Requirements

  • 3+ years development / devops experience
  • 2+ years of experience with Linux, Windows and Mac environment fundamentals
  • Basic understanding of popular backend languages (Python, Java, NodeJS and PHP)
  • Prior experience or understanding of database- and server configuration (MongoDB, SQL, MySQL)
  • Prior experience or understanding of Git
  • Proficiency in multiple programming languages and software development tools
  • Strong ability to analyze technical documentation and identify key requirements
  • Excellent problem-solving abilities to diagnose and resolve complex software issues
  • Effective communication skills, both verbal and written, for collaborating with teams and clients
  • Ability to adapt to various programming environments and quickly learn new technologies
  • Strong team player with the ability to work in cross-functional teams
  • Excellent organizational and time-management skills, with the ability to handle multiple tasks simultaneously

Responsibilities

  • Conduct verification of customer software using provided technical documentation
  • Achieve software builds across various programming languages
  • Identify, diagnose, and resolve build issues, ensuring software meets quality standards
  • Analyze software requirements and technical documentation to understand build processes and dependencies
  • Communicate effectively with team members and clients to understand requirements and provide updates
  • Stay updated with emerging technologies and programming languages relevant to software verification
  • Contribute to the continuous improvement of verification processes and practices
  • Assist in backend and frontend development tasks as required
  • Participate in DevOps activities, including CI/CD pipeline development and maintenance

Preferred Qualifications

  • Basic knowledge of front-end languages HTML, CSS, and JavaScript
  • Basic knowledge of AWS technologies
  • Basic knowledge of API configuration
  • Experience with various build tools, like (but not specifically) msbuild, webpack, maven, and others of the type

Benefits

  • Passionate and fun-loving colleagues
  • Startup mindset with ample opportunities for growth
  • Regular team activities and gatherings
  • Comprehensive onboarding process with a dedicated ramp-up period
  • A supportive team that values open communication and direct feedback
  • A chance to excel in your career and make a difference
  • Remote work

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.